Angel Lake (Humboldt-toiyabe National Forest, NV)
Angel Lake Campground, situated at 8,400 feet in the East Humboldt Mountain Range, is 12 miles from Wells, Nevada. The area offers activities such as canoeing, fishing, hiking, and wildlife viewing. It is known for its picturesque surroundings.

Notch Peak Trailhead
Notch Peak, located in Utah's House Range Complex, is managed by the BLM Fillmore Field Office. It offers opportunities for hiking, camping, and wildlife viewing. The area is popular among outdoor enthusiasts for its natural beauty.
